COL Jelenne J Quintana NC (MNSA) is a distinguished leader whose unwavering commitment to excellence in nursing practice makes her a fitting recipient of the DAISY Nurse Leader Award. In her role as the Army Chief Nurse, she serves as a trusted advisor to the Commanding General of the Philippine Army on all matters relating to the Nurse Corps, demonstrating strategic insight and expertise in shaping policies and operational frameworks for the Philippine Army Nursing Service. Her leadership is integral in ensuring that nursing standards are upheld across all Philippine Army Military Treatment Facilities, overseeing the adherence of Nursing Service personnel to established rules, regulations, and standard operating procedures.
The Army Chief Nurse's dedication to the delivery of high-quality care is evident through her regular assessments of nursing service requirements, conducting staff visits and inspections to identify areas for improvement and ensure that resources are optimally allocated to meet the needs of Army personnel. Moreover, she plays a central role in the recruitment, appointment, promotion, retention, and separation of Nurse Corps officers, working closely with the Chief Nurse of the Armed Forces of the Philippines to ensure that personnel decisions are aligned with the strategic needs of the organization. Her influence extends to the coordination of policies affecting the PA Nursing Service, ensuring that nursing matters are integrated into the broader context of the PA Medical Service.
Through ongoing communication with commanders and Chief Nurses in subordinate units, she ensures that nursing personnel assignments and other matters affecting the well-being of officers are managed with precision and care. A champion of professional development, she plans and implements training programs that foster the career growth of nursing personnel, empowering them to achieve their fullest potential within the Army. Her attention to detail in the management of personnel assignments, reassignments, and the procurement and retention of Nurse Corps officers ensures that the Nursing Service operates with efficiency and effectiveness.
Additionally, her oversight of the Nursing Service budget and the continuous maintenance of the Nursing Service Management Information System further underscore her commitment to maintaining a sustainable and operationally robust nursing service. Above all, COL Jelenne J Quintana NC (MNSA) maintains the highest standards of nursing practice, ensuring that the Philippine Army Nursing Service delivers exemplary care to soldiers and their families, exemplifying the values of leadership, dedication, and service that the DAISY Nurse Leader Award seeks to honor.
Note: This is COL Quintana's 2nd DAISY Award!
